
Teddy Bears, Stuffed Animals to Take the Ice on Friday
November 30, 2011 - ECHL (ECHL)
Las Vegas Wranglers News Release
Las Vegas - The Las Vegas Wranglers will welcome special opponents to the ice on Friday, Dec. 2, for the team's 9th annual Teddy Bear Toss. The Fremont Street Fuzzies, whose fuzziness is only matched by their fierceness, will face off against the Wranglers to benefit Sunrise Acres Elementary School in eastern Las Vegas.
Leading the line-up for the Fuzzies is Winnie the Pooh, who has been the team's captain for the past two seasons, with Paddington Bear and Elmo as respective left and right wings. Teddy Ruxpin and Fozzie Bear will bolster the blue line, and Sock Monkey has been named goaltender for the match with a 0.875 save percentage. Mr. Potato Head will be behind the bench as the team's head coach. The Wranglers have not announced their line-up for Friday.
To support the Fuzzies, fans can bring new teddy bears and other stuffed animals to throw onto the ice after the Wranglers score their first goal of the night. Fans will receive a raffle ticket for each stuffed animal donated that enters them into a drawing for various prizes.
"The more stuffed animals on the ice means more support for the team," said Fuzzy Wuzzy, forward for Fremont Street. "It shows the Wranglers that we're about to stuff them with some goals of our own."
The puck drops at 7:05 p.m. at Orleans Arena.
